CORONATION Street star Kym Marsh has made little Aalish Naylor’s dream come true by inviting her for a tour of the famous cobbled street.
Aalish, who has undergone gruelling cancer treatment for neuroblastoma, had longed to meet Kym, who plays Rovers Return landlady Michelle.
Her dream came true after a friend of Kym’s saw a Facebook post by Aalish’s mum Jo and Kym even showed her round on her day off.
Jo, 40, of Hawthorne Crescent, Dodworth, said: “It was absolutely brilliant and Aalish thoroughly enjoyed it.
“Kym was amazing. She crouched down on her knees and gave Aalish a big cuddle and it was like they had known each other for years.”
Aalish, seven, visited Roy’s Rolls, Audrey’s salon, Dev’s coroner shop, the garage, the kebab shop, and of course, the Rovers Return where she posed with Kym and brother Jack, ten, behind the bar.
Aalish is currently having tests having undergone immunotherapy treatment.
Her family are hoping to result come back clear and Aalish can ring the bell at the children’s hospital to signal she is in remission.
Kym has asked to be kept informed.
